ChemInform Abstract: Formation of α-Dialkylamino Alkyllithium Intermediates in the Reaction of N,N-Dialkylamides with PhMe2SiLi Followed by a Second Lithium Reagent, and Their Alkylation, Fragmentation, Cyclization and Rearrangement by Proton Transfer.

ChemInform Abstract
The reaction of tertiary amides, e.g. (I), with Ph-SiMe2Li and a second lithium reagent leads to α-dialkylamino alkyllithium intermediates, which undergo protonation, cf. products (III), β-elimination, cf. compound (VI), intramolecular reaction to give product (X) or intramolecular proton transfer, cf. compound (XII).
